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Please refer to fig. 1-4, an efficient bubble cleaning machine for food manufacturing, comprising a box body 1, the upside of the box body 1 is connected with a frame 2, the top of the inner wall of the frame 2 is connected with a cylinder body 3, a plurality of through holes 4 are opened on the peripheral side of the cylinder body 3, the bottom of the inner wall of the cylinder body 3 is connected with a shielding mechanism 5 and one side of the shielding mechanism 5 is attached to the surface of the through hole 4, one side of the box body 1 is communicated with a water pump 6, the water outlet of the water pump 6 is connected with a pipeline 7, the pipeline 7 is of a U-shaped rod structure, and the water outlet of the pipeline 7 is located above the cylinder body 3, the inner wall of the cylinder body 3 is connected with an air pump 8, the air outlet of the air pump 8 is connected with an air outlet pipe 9, and the air outlet pipe 9 is located in the cylinder body 3, the cooperation of the air pump 8 and the air outlet pipe 9 can generate bubbles in water to clean food.
Specifically, be connected with connecting pipe 10 between the delivery port of water pump 6 and box 1, connecting pipe 10 can make things convenient for water pump 6 to take out the water in the box 1.
Specifically, the shielding mechanism 5 includes: the cross plate 501 is rotatably connected to the bottom of the inner wall of the barrel 3, the positioning plate 502 is connected above the cross plate 501 and is attached to the periphery of the inner wall of the barrel 3, the length of the positioning plate 502 is larger than that of the barrel 3, the width of the positioning plate 502 is larger than that of the through hole 4, and the positioning plate 502 can better shield the through hole 4.
Specifically, recess 504 has been seted up to the top of locating plate 502, elastic fit has card pole 503 on the length direction of recess 504, the draw-in groove with card pole 503 looks adaptation is seted up to the top of box 1, through the card pole 503 that sets up, card pole 503 can be fixed the position of locating plate 502, the condition emergence that the cancellation sheltered from to through-hole 4 appears in the rotation of having avoided locating plate 502 because of barrel 3, the straight flute has been seted up to one side of recess 504, one side of card pole 503 is connected with the arch of sliding fit in the straight flute, be connected with the spring between arch and the straight flute.
Specifically, the below of barrel 3 inner wall is connected with dwang 11, and the one end that dwang 11 passed frame 2 is connected with worm wheel 12, and one side of frame 2 is connected with rotary driving mechanism, and rotary driving mechanism can be self-locking motor/revolving cylinder, and rotary driving mechanism's output is connected with the worm 13 with worm wheel 12 meshing, can drive barrel 3 through the cooperation of worm 13 and worm wheel 12 and rotate, and reach the effect that produces the centrifugal force.
Specifically, a filtering hole 14 is formed between the inner wall and the outer wall below the frame 2, the filtering hole 14 is located above the box body 1, and the filtering hole 14 can collect and transmit water flowing out of the barrel body 3 into the box body 1.
Specifically, the upper part of the frame 2 is rotatably connected with a cover plate 15 matched with the opening of the frame 2, and the barrel 3 can be sealed by the arranged cover plate 15 when food is centrifuged.
The working principle is as follows: when food needs to be cleaned, a person firstly pours water into the box body 1, then starts the water pump 6, so that the water in the box body 1 is pumped out by the water pump 6 through the connecting pipe 10, then the water can enter the barrel body 3 through the pipeline 7, because the barrel body 3 is shielded by the shielding mechanism, the water can be left in the shielding mechanism, then the person starts the air pump 8, so that the air pump 8 foams the water in the barrel body 3 through the air outlet pipe 9 to achieve the cleaning effect, then the person pulls the clamping rod 503 upwards to enable the clamping rod 503 to extrude the spring and slide out from the clamping groove, then rotates the positioning plate 502 to enable the cross plate 501 to rotate along the bottom of the inner wall of the barrel body 3, meanwhile, the positioning plate 502 can cancel shielding of the through hole 4, then the water in the barrel body 3 can flow out along the through hole 4, and then enters the frame 2, then the water in the frame 2 can flow into the box body 1 through filtering of the filtering hole 14, then the personnel promote apron 15, make apron 15 shelter from the frame 2 opening part, then open the rotation driving mechanism, make the worm 13 who is connected with the rotation driving mechanism output rotate, then worm 13 passes through worm wheel 12 drive barrel 3 and rotates and produce centrifugal force and reach the effect of clearing up the food.
